What is Rcd1.dll?

A DLL (Dynamic Link Library) file is a type of file that contains code and data that can be used by multiple programs at the same time. Specifically, the rcd1.dll file is an important part of the BVS Solitaire Plus Pack software. This DLL file contains functions and resources that are used by the BVS Solitaire Plus Pack to help it run smoothly and efficiently.

Without the rcd1.dll file, the BVS Solitaire Plus Pack may not function properly or may not even launch at all. In the context of the BVS Solitaire Plus Pack, the rcd1.dll file plays a crucial role in providing the necessary code and resources for the software to work as intended. It helps the software communicate with the computer's operating system and perform various tasks that are essential for playing the solitaire games included in the pack.

Therefore, the rcd1.dll file is extremely important for the proper functioning of the BVS Solitaire Plus Pack.

DLL files often play a critical role in system operations. Despite their importance, these files can sometimes source system errors. Below we consider some of the most frequently encountered faults associated with DLL files.

  • The file rcd1.dll is missing: This suggests that a DLL file required for certain functionalities is not available in your system. This could have occurred due to manual deletion, system restore, or a recent software uninstallation.
  • Rcd1.dll could not be loaded: This error indicates that the DLL file, necessary for certain operations, couldn't be loaded by the system. Potential causes might include missing DLL files, DLL files that are not properly registered in the system, or conflicts with other software.
  • This application failed to start because rcd1.dll was not found. Re-installing the application may fix this problem: This error is thrown when a necessary DLL file is not found by the application. It might have been accidentally deleted or misplaced. Reinstallation of the application can possibly resolve this issue by replacing the missing DLL file.
  • Rcd1.dll is either not designed to run on Windows or it contains an error: This error typically signifies that the DLL file may be incompatible with your version of Windows, or it's corrupted. It can also occur if you're trying to run a DLL file meant for a different system architecture (for instance, a 64-bit DLL on a 32-bit system).
  • Rcd1.dll not found: The required DLL file is absent from the expected directory. This can result from software uninstalls, updates, or system changes that mistakenly remove or relocate DLL files.

Run the Deployment Image Servicing and Management (DISM) to Fix the Rcd1.dll Errors

Run the Deployment Image Servicing and Management (DISM) to Fix the Rcd1.dll Errors Thumbnail
Difficulty
Intermediate
Steps
6
Time Required
10 minutes
Sections
3
Description

In this guide, we will aim to resolve issues related to rcd1.dll by utilizing the (DISM) tool.

Step 1: Open Command Prompt

Step 1: Open Command Prompt Thumbnail
  1. Press the Windows key.

  2. Type Command Prompt in the search bar.

  3.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.

Step 2: Run DISM Scan

Step 2: Run DISM Scan Thumbnail
  1. In the Command Prompt window, type DISM /Online /Cleanup-Image /RestoreHealth and press Enter.

  2. Allow the Deployment Image Servicing and Management tool to scan your system and correct any errors it detects.

Step 3: Review Results

Step 3: Review Results Thumbnail
  1. Review the results once the scan is completed.
